This Korean restaurant instantly reminded me of my mom’s home-cooked meals! The quality of the food was so fresh and clean, and I loved that it wasn’t heavily salted. I’m so happy I found this amazing spot. I honestly don’t mind driving about 40 minutes just to eat here.

We ordered the Galbitang, a comforting short rib soup with tender galbi ribs, noodles, and a rich, flavorful broth. It was absolutely delicious. But the standout for me was the Seolleongtang a nourishing ox bone soup with noodles, topped with chadol brisket and fresh green onions. It was light and healthy!

The sides and kimchi were also superb so fresh and full of flavor, just like my mom’s cooking. On top of the amazing food, the service was warm and attentive, and the ambiance felt cozy and welcoming, making the whole experience even better.

I’ll definitely be back to try more dishes from this wonderful Korean restaurant!

Wow!! 1st impression as I walked in, this place feels comfortable. I felt welcome. The waitress was friendly and she was on top of her game. She sat us down and gave us time to look at the menu. She wasn’t pushy and she didn’t hover. When we were ready to order, she knew.

This was my first time here. I came with my daughter. Neither of us were ready for all the side orders that came. If you’re a fan of kimchi, you’ll be very happy. The rice was perfectly cooked.

When our food came, our jaws dropped. The portion size was impressive. It was delicious. I had the fish cutlets and my daughter had the galbi. Yum!! We didn’t finish and we had to get boxes.

I’m a guy in my 50s. I’m a grumpy man. I don’t have patience for bad food or bad service. That wasn’t a problem here. We both left with a smile. Next time, I come I’m having what my daughter had. It was a mountain of beef.

This is our second time visiting, and both times the food and service were amazing. We usually order the Yukgaejang, and this place truly serves one of the best around. The broth is thick, the meat is flavorful, and every bite feels comforting. Their fish pancakes were also delicious and perfectly cooked. Sodam really lives up to its name by offering a satisfying and memorable dining experience. I highly recommend this place to anyone looking for authentic Korean soups in SCV. It is a must-visit and has become our favorite spot from now on.
